Introduction:

In the world of timeshare ownership, legal disputes are common. Bluegreen Vacations has filed a civil action against Timeshare Lawyers and other defendants, shedding light on alleged deceptive tactics. This blog post explores the case's intricacies, deceptive practices, court rulings, and the pursuit of equitable relief.

False Advertising, Tortious Interference, and Civil Conspiracy:

Bluegreen, a renowned company in the hospitality industry, has recently brought forth a legal case against the defendants. The accusations listed are false advertising, tortious interference with contracts, civil conspiracy, and violation of Florida's Deceptive and Unfair Trade Practices Act. These allegations represent serious breaches of ethical conduct, affecting not only Bluegreen but also numerous customers who have been impacted by the defendants' actions.

To fully comprehend the gravity of the situation, it is important to delve into each accusation. False advertising is a deceptive practice that misleads potential customers, leading them to make decisions based on false pretenses. Such behavior undermines the trust and integrity that customers place in businesses and can have severe repercussions for a company's reputation and bottom line.

Tortious interference with contracts involves intentionally disrupting contractual relationships between parties, causing financial harm to one or both parties involved. In the case of Bluegreen, this interference is likely to have caused significant disruptions in their business operations, affecting their ability to fulfill their contractual obligations.

The accusation of civil conspiracy suggests that the defendants conspired together to engage in unlawful activities, specifically targeting Bluegreen and its customers. This concerted effort to harm the company's interests is a grave matter that warrants legal intervention.

In addition to these accusations, Bluegreen has also alleged a violation of Florida's Deceptive and Unfair Trade Practices Act. This legislation is in place to protect consumers from unfair business practices, ensuring that they are provided with accurate information and are not subjected to deceptive tactics.

Parties Involved: Unveiling Deceptive Tactics

The primary adversaries are Bluegreen and Timeshare Lawyers, with the Marketing Defendants accused of engaging in deceptive practices aimed at timeshare owners. Pandora Marketing employed deceptive methods and collaborations to convince owners to breach their contracts, making false promises along the way. Testimonies from affected owners provide additional support for these claims. The Marketing Defendants intentionally misled owners about credit protection, even altering their claims to "credit management" to avoid legal consequences. Pandora Marketing utilized deceptive tactics, including scripts and working alongside a credit repair service, to deceive owners into believing in a misleading "constructive exit." Owners who followed Pandora Marketing's advice experienced contract breaches and damage to their credit, contrary to the promises made.

Lawyer Defendants further compounded the deception by directing owners towards fraudulent legal services to expedite their timeshare exits. As a result, Bluegreen faced significant revenue losses, carrying costs, and an inability to sell inventory due to the defendants' rampant contract breaches. The Marketing Defendants violated the Lanham Act through false advertising, causing harm to Bluegreen. In assessing damages, the court considers equitable principles and holds the defendants accountable for their deliberate misconduct, ensuring a fair outcome.

Conclusion

Bluegreen successfully establishes claims of tortious interference with contracts and civil conspiracy against the defendants, solidifying their deceptive practices. The defendants' acts and practices clearly violate Florida's Deceptive and Unfair Trade Practices Act. To address the ongoing deception and protect timeshare owners, Bluegreen seeks injunctive relief as a necessary legal recourse.
